The Service Porter helps ensure complete customer satisfaction by moving vehicles in and around the Service area, maintaining the cleanliness of vehicles, and transporting customers to/from their home when needed. Compensation: $21 - $24/hour Responsibilities: Assist with service write-ups and tagging of customer cars and trucks Remove vehicle protective coverings and ID tags prior to returning completed vehicle to customer Inspect vehicles for stains, debris and damages before returning the vehicle to the customer, and report any damage immediately Transport customers and dealership personnel as needed Perform deliveries as required Clean interior and exterior of new and used vehicles Keep vehicle lot neat and orderly, moving units as directed and in accordance with dealership display standards Return vehicle keys to the appropriate service consultant Pick up vehicles from and deliver vehicles to storage Pick up parts from the Parts Department Maintains building and ground as needed Assist with shop clean-up and deliveries when needed Requirements: 19+ years or older to be insured within the company. 6-12 months of previous work experience (preferred) High school diploma or GED preferred. Unrestricted California driver's license and clean driving record. Able to drive both automatic and standard-transmission vehicles and safely operate vehicles in tight spaces. Highly professional and dependable. Excellent communication, customer service, and problem-solving skills, including the ability to maintain composure under stress. Able to work independently with minimal supervision. Basic computer and internet skills. Must be customer service oriented. Must be a team player with a strong sense of commitment to the customer and team members. Must be self-motivated with good written and verbal communication skills. Friendly with high energy and the willingness to go above and beyond. Previous experience in a similar role is a plus.
